Lines Matching refs:_Compare
395 class _Compare = less<typename _Container::value_type> >
400 typedef _Compare value_compare;
524 template <class _Tp, class _Container, class _Compare>
526 priority_queue<_Tp, _Container, _Compare>::priority_queue(const _Compare& __comp,
536 template <class _Tp, class _Container, class _Compare>
538 priority_queue<_Tp, _Container, _Compare>::priority_queue(const value_compare& __comp,
548 template <class _Tp, class _Container, class _Compare>
551 priority_queue<_Tp, _Container, _Compare>::priority_queue(_InputIter __f, _InputIter __l,
559 template <class _Tp, class _Container, class _Compare>
562 priority_queue<_Tp, _Container, _Compare>::priority_queue(_InputIter __f, _InputIter __l,
574 template <class _Tp, class _Container, class _Compare>
577 priority_queue<_Tp, _Container, _Compare>::priority_queue(_InputIter __f, _InputIter __l,
589 template <class _Tp, class _Container, class _Compare>
592 priority_queue<_Tp, _Container, _Compare>::priority_queue(const _Alloc& __a,
599 template <class _Tp, class _Container, class _Compare>
602 priority_queue<_Tp, _Container, _Compare>::priority_queue(const value_compare& __comp,
611 template <class _Tp, class _Container, class _Compare>
614 priority_queue<_Tp, _Container, _Compare>::priority_queue(const value_compare& __comp,
625 template <class _Tp, class _Container, class _Compare>
628 priority_queue<_Tp, _Container, _Compare>::priority_queue(const priority_queue& __q,
640 template <class _Tp, class _Container, class _Compare>
643 priority_queue<_Tp, _Container, _Compare>::priority_queue(const value_compare& __comp,
654 template <class _Tp, class _Container, class _Compare>
657 priority_queue<_Tp, _Container, _Compare>::priority_queue(priority_queue&& __q,
669 template <class _Tp, class _Container, class _Compare>
672 priority_queue<_Tp, _Container, _Compare>::push(const value_type& __v)
680 template <class _Tp, class _Container, class _Compare>
683 priority_queue<_Tp, _Container, _Compare>::push(value_type&& __v)
691 template <class _Tp, class _Container, class _Compare>
695 priority_queue<_Tp, _Container, _Compare>::emplace(_Args&&... __args)
704 template <class _Tp, class _Container, class _Compare>
707 priority_queue<_Tp, _Container, _Compare>::pop()
713 template <class _Tp, class _Container, class _Compare>
716 priority_queue<_Tp, _Container, _Compare>::swap(priority_queue& __q)
725 template <class _Tp, class _Container, class _Compare>
729 && __is_swappable<_Compare>::value,
732 swap(priority_queue<_Tp, _Container, _Compare>& __x,
733 priority_queue<_Tp, _Container, _Compare>& __y)
739 template <class _Tp, class _Container, class _Compare, class _Alloc>
740 struct _LIBCPP_TEMPLATE_VIS uses_allocator<priority_queue<_Tp, _Container, _Compare>, _Alloc>